3. Why Choose Steel Doors in the USA? The Core Benefits
When you’re weighing your options, the “why” behind steel becomes crystal clear. This isn’t the hollow, uninsulated metal door you might remember from a utility shed. Today’s steel doors are precision-engineered systems.
Unmatched Security and Durability
This is, without a doubt, the number one reason clients in the US choose steel.
- Sheer Strength: Steel is inherently stronger than wood or fiberglass. It doesn’t crack, warp, or bow under pressure or from extreme weather changes, which is a common complaint with wooden doors in fluctuating US climates.
- Forced Entry Resistance: A steel door, especially one with a steel frame and a lower gauge (thicker) skin, is exceptionally difficult to kick in or pry open. The steel edge and lock-side reinforcements create a formidable barrier. From my experience, a properly installed steel door with a high-quality deadbolt is the single best security upgrade you can make to your home’s perimeter.
Exceptional Energy Efficiency for US Climates
It’s a common misconception that steel doors are cold. The steel is just a skin; the real performer is the insulated core.
- High R-Value: Most steel doors are injected with a high-density polyurethane or polystyrene foam, creating an insulated barrier with an R-value (a measure of thermal resistance) that can be five times greater than that of a solid wood door of the same size.
- ENERGY STAR® Rating: This high R-value means the door is incredibly effective at keeping your heated air inside during a Boston winter and your air-conditioned air inside during a Phoenix summer. Many steel doors meet the strict criteria to be ENERGY STAR certified models, which can lower your utility bills and may even qualify you for local energy rebates.
- Thermal Break: Quality steel doors designed for cold climates feature a “thermal break”—a composite material that separates the interior and exterior steel skins. This prevents the transfer of cold and stops frost from forming on the inside of your door.
Low Maintenance and Weather Resistance
If you’re tired of sanding, staining, and painting a wooden door every few years, steel is your solution.
- Minimal Upkeep: Modern steel doors come with a factory-applied, baked-on primer and finish that is incredibly tough. An occasional wipe-down with mild soap and water is typically all that’s required.
- Rust Resistance: This is a common concern, but it’s largely a problem of the past. Today’s doors are made from galvanized (zinc-coated) steel, which chemically resists rust and corrosion, even in damp or coastal US climates. Unless the finish is deeply gouged down to the bare metal and left untreated, rust is simply not an issue.
Superior Fire Protection
Safety is a key component of security. Steel doors are naturally fire-resistant. Unlike wood or fiberglass, steel does not burn. Many steel doors carry a 20-minute fire rating, which is often required by US building codes for the door connecting your garage to your home. This rating means the door can withstand intense heat and block the spread of a fire for 20 minutes, giving your family critical time to escape. This is often guided by National Fire Protection Association (NFPA) standards, which set the benchmark for fire safety in building construction.
4. Decoding the Specs: How to Read a Steel Door Label
When shopping, you’ll be hit with terms like “24-gauge” and “polyurethane core.” Here’s what you actually need to know.
Steel Gauge Explained: Why Lower is Stronger
The single most important specification for security is the gauge of the steel. In the world of sheet metal, the terminology is counter-intuitive: the lower the gauge number, the thicker and stronger the steel.
- 20-22 Gauge: This is a premium, heavy-duty range. You’ll find this on high-end residential doors. The steel is noticeably thicker and far more resistant to dents and forced entry. I always recommend at least 22-gauge for a primary entry door.
- 24-26 Gauge: This is the most common and budget-friendly range. A 24-gauge door is still a very secure and effective option for most US homes. I would be cautious about doors thinner than 26-gauge, as they can be more susceptible to dents from everyday impacts.
The Core of the Matter: Insulation Types
The material inside the steel skins dictates your door’s energy efficiency (R-value) and sound-dampening qualities.
- Polyurethane Foam: This is the superior, high-end option. The foam is injected as a liquid and expands to fill every single cavity inside the door panel, bonding directly to the steel skins. This creates an incredibly strong, rigid panel with the highest possible R-value (typically R-12 to R-16).
- Polystyrene Foam: This is a solid, rigid foam board (like a styrofoam cooler) that is cut to size and placed inside the door. It’s a very good, cost-effective insulator (typically R-8 to R-10) but doesn’t offer the same structural rigidity or complete, gap-free insulation as polyurethane.
- Honeycomb Core: You may see this on very cheap, interior, or light-commercial doors. It’s essentially a cardboard or paper-based honeycomb structure. It offers minimal insulation and sound-proofing and should be avoided for any exterior residential application in the US.
Comparison: Polyurethane vs. Polystyrene Core
| Feature | Polyurethane Core | Polystyrene Core |
| Insulation (R-Value) | Highest (R-12 to R-16) | Good (R-8 to R-10) |
| Structural Rigidity | Excellent. Bonds to steel, increasing strength. | Good. Acts as a panel but doesn’t bond. |
| Sound Dampening | Excellent. Fills all cavities, muffling sound. | Good. Effective, but small gaps can exist. |
| Cost | Higher | More Budget-Friendly |
| Best For | All US climates, especially very cold or hot zones. | Moderate US climates; budget-conscious buyers. |
Pro Tip: From my experience, the upgrade to a polyurethane core is almost always worth the investment, especially in states with extreme winters or summers. The long-term energy savings and the solid, substantial feel of the door are significant benefits.
5. People Also Ask: Quick Answers on Steel Doors in the USA
- Are steel doors better than fiberglass?It’s a trade-off. Steel is generally stronger, more secure, and less expensive. Fiberglass is more resistant to dents and scratches and often offers a more realistic wood-grain texture. Both are excellent, energy-efficient choices for US homes.
- Do steel doors rust in the USA?Modern, high-quality steel doors do not rust under normal conditions. They are made from galvanized (zinc-coated) steel and have durable, factory-applied finishes. Rust would only become a problem if the door was deeply scratched to the bare metal and left un-repaired in a very wet environment.
- How much do steel doors cost in the US?Costs vary dramatically. A basic, 24-gauge, unpainted steel utility door from a big-box store might start around $250. A high-end, 20-gauge, polyurethane-insulated steel entry system with decorative glass, sidelights, and a premium finish can cost $3,000 to $6,000 or more, plus installation.
- Are steel doors energy efficient?Yes, exceptionally so. A steel door’s efficiency comes from its insulated foam core, not the steel itself. A quality steel door has a much higher R-value than a solid wood door and provides an excellent seal against drafts, saving money on US energy bills.
6. Choosing the Right Steel Door for Your US Region
The “best” steel door in USA is highly dependent on your location. A door that’s perfect for Miami will fail in Minneapolis if not specced correctly.
Considerations for Coastal & Humid Areas (e.g., Florida, Gulf Coast, Southeast)
- Priority: Corrosion and impact resistance.
- What to look for: While galvanization is standard, look for doors with a high-quality, factory-applied paint or PVC-vinyl coating for an extra layer of protection against salt and moisture. In hurricane-prone areas, you must look for doors with a specific “impact rating” or “hurricane rating” to comply with local building codes.
Specs for Cold Climates (e.g., Northeast, Midwest)
- Priority: Maximum thermal performance.
- What to look for:
- Polyurethane Core: Non-negotiable for the highest R-value.
- Thermal Break: Essential to prevent frost from building up on the inside of the door.
- High-Quality Weatherstripping: Look for a system with a magnetic or compression seal and a bottom sweep that creates a tight barrier against drafts.
A Note on US Building Codes and HOAs
Before you buy, always check two things. First, your local building codes, especially for fire-rating requirements (like the garage-to-home door) or impact ratings (in coastal areas). Second, if you live in a community governed by a Homeowners Association (HOA), check their bylaws. They often have strict rules about front door styles and colors.
7. Installation and Maintenance of Steel Doors in the USA
A $5,000 door installed poorly will perform worse than a $500 door installed perfectly. The installation is critical.
DIY vs. Professional Installation: A Realistic Look
I’ve seen many ambitious DIY projects go wrong. While replacing a “slab” (the door only) is sometimes possible, most modern entry doors are sold as “pre-hung” systems, which include the door, frame, and threshold. Installing a pre-hung unit requires it to be perfectly level, plumb, and square. If it’s even 1/8th of an inch off, the door will not seal correctly, leading to drafts, water leaks, and a lock that doesn’t engage properly.
Unless you are a very experienced carpenter, I strongly recommend a professional installation. This ensures your warranty is valid, the door seals properly for maximum energy efficiency, and the security features are all correctly aligned.
Checklist: Preparing for Your New Door Installation
- Clear the Area: Ensure your installer has a wide-open space to work, both inside and outside the entryway. Move furniture, rugs, and any wall hangings near the door.
- Protect Your Floors: Lay down drop cloths or cardboard to protect your flooring from tools and debris.
- Secure Pets: For their safety and to prevent escapes, keep pets in a separate, secure room.
- Check the New Door: Before the old door comes off, inspect the new, pre-hung unit with the installer. Confirm the style, color, finish, and (especially) the swing direction (inswing/outswing, left-hand/right-hand) are all correct.
- Discuss the Trim: Talk to the installer about the plan for the interior and exterior trim (casing). Will the old trim be re-used, or will new trim be installed?
- Allow Time: A standard, single-door replacement can take a professional 3-5 hours. Be patient and let them do the job right.
Maintenance Tip: Your steel door is low-maintenance, not no-maintenance. Once a year, check and clean the weatherstripping and bottom sweep. If you see any deep scratches that show bare metal, clean the spot and apply a small dab of touch-up paint (available from the manufacturer) to prevent any chance of rust. 8. The New Look of Steel: Aesthetics and Customization
Forget the idea of a flat, gray, industrial-looking door. The
steel door industry in the USA has undergone a design revolution.
- Finishes: You are no longer limited to basic white or beige. Modern steel doors can be factory-painted in a huge spectrum of colors, from bold reds to subtle charcoals.
- Wood-Grain Texture: The most significant advancement is the high-definition, embossed wood-grain finish. A high-quality steel door can mimic the look and feel of an oak, mahogany, or fir door so realistically that it’s difficult to tell the difference from the curb.
- Glass Inserts (“Lites”): You can customize your door with a huge variety of glass options—from full-view glass panels for a modern look to decorative, privacy, or frosted glass that lets in light while obscuring the view.
9. In-Depth Q&A on Steel Doors in USA
- Q1: What is a “thermal break” in a steel door and do I need one in the US?A thermal break is a small strip of non-conductive material (like a composite or vinyl) that is placed between the inside and outside steel skins of the door, usually in the frame. Steel is a conductor, so on a very cold day, the outside steel gets cold. Without a thermal break, this cold would travel directly to the inside steel, causing condensation or frost to form on your interior door surface. If you live in a US climate with cold winters (anywhere in the Northern or Central US), a thermal break is absolutely essential.
- Q2: What is the difference between a 20-gauge and a 24-gauge steel door?This is a common point of confusion. The lower the gauge number, the thicker the steel. A 20-gauge steel door is significantly thicker, stronger, and more dent-resistant than a 24-gauge door. A 24-gauge door is a solid standard, but a 20- or 22-gauge door is a “premium” security upgrade.
- Q3: What do fire ratings (e.g., 20-minute) on steel doors mean?A fire rating indicates how long a door and frame assembly can withstand a standardized fire test and prevent the spread of flames and, to some extent, heat. A “20-minute” rating is the most common for residential use and is often required by US building codes for the door between an attached garage and the living area of a house.
- Q4: How do I maintain my steel door to maximize its lifespan in the US climate?Maintenance is minimal. Once a year, wipe down the door surface with a soft cloth and mild dish soap. Check the weather-stripping for any cracks or compression and replace it if it’s no longer sealing. Lubricate the hinges and lockset with a graphite-based lubricant. Finally, inspect the finish for any deep scratches and apply touch-up paint immediately to protect the galvanized steel underneath.
- Q5: Can I replace just the steel door ‘slab’ or do I need the whole frame (a ‘pre-hung’ system)?While you can buy just the “slab” (the door itself), it is almost always a bad idea for an exterior door. Getting a new slab to fit an old, existing frame perfectly is incredibly difficult, even for a professional. The house may have settled, and the old frame may no longer be perfectly square. This leads to gaps, drafts, and security issues. A “pre-hung” system includes the door, frame, threshold, and weather-stripping, all factory-engineered to work together for a perfect, weather-tight seal.
